Gluconeogenesis is a form of anabolism. It is the synthesis of glucose from non-carbohydrate sources such as pyruvate, lactate, glycerol, alanine, or glutamate, and primarily takes place in the liver. This metabolic pathway is activated during periods of fasting, starvation, or low carbohydrate intake to maintain blood glucose levels. Anabolic pathways are biosynthetic; they build complex molecules from simpler ones, which is the opposite of catabolic reactions that break down molecules for energy.

An example of a catabolic process is glycolysis, where glucose is broken down to yield energy. In contrast, gluconeogenesis is anabolic because it involves the creation of new glucose molecules, necessary to provide energy for essential organs, particularly the brain, which requires glucose as its primary energy source.
